The speech recognition industry has undergone a significant transformation in 2026, marking the end of OpenAI's Whisper's monopolistic hold on open-source automatic speech recognition (ASR). Multiple competitive models have emerged with performance metrics so closely aligned that traditional ranking systems no longer effectively differentiate between them. This shift represents a maturation of the ASR market, offering developers and organizations unprecedented choice in selecting speech recognition solutions that best match their specific requirements.

The open ASR landscape now features several high-performing alternatives competing at nearly identical accuracy levels. Cohere Transcribe, IBM Granite Speech 4.1, ARK-ASR, and MOSS-Transcribe have all achieved Word Error Rate (WER) scores separated by less than one percentage point on the Hugging Face Open ASR Leaderboard. This convergence in performance means that model selection increasingly depends on factors beyond raw accuracy metrics, including supported languages, inference latency, licensing terms, and computational requirements.
